节点服务器:分布式网络的核心引擎
节点服务器是什么意思

首页 2024-10-13 01:58:36



节点服务器:分布式系统的核心力量 在当今这个数据爆炸、网络互联的时代,节点服务器(Network Node Server, NNS)作为分布式系统的核心组成部分,正发挥着不可估量的作用

    节点服务器不仅是数据传输和处理的枢纽,更是确保系统稳定性、扩展性和高效性的关键所在

    本文将深入探讨节点服务器的定义、功能、优势及其在各类分布式系统中的应用,揭示其在现代信息技术中的重要地位

     定义与概述 节点服务器,顾名思义,是在分布式系统中扮演节点角色的服务器

    它们通过网络连接相互通信和协作,共同完成系统中的任务和功能

    节点服务器可以是物理服务器或虚拟机,无论位于同一台机器上还是分布在不同地点,都能通过高效的通信机制紧密协作

    每个节点服务器都拥有唯一的标识,以便在系统中进行精确识别和通信

     核心功能与特点 1.高可靠性:节点服务器采用分布式架构,各节点之间具备冗余备份机制

    这意味着即使某个节点发生故障,系统也能通过其他节点继续运行,从而保障了整个系统的稳定性和连续性

     2.高扩展性:随着业务需求的增长,节点服务器可以轻松添加或移除节点,以适应系统规模的变化

    这种灵活的扩展能力使得分布式系统能够应对各种复杂的场景和需求

     3.高并发性:节点服务器能够同时处理多个并发请求,有效提升了系统的整体性能

    在高峰时段或大规模数据处理场景中,这一特点尤为关键

     4.任务分发与调度:节点服务器具备智能的任务分发和调度能力,能够根据任务的类型和优先级,将任务分配给最合适的节点执行

    这种机制确保了任务的高效完成和资源的合理利用

     5.节点管理:节点服务器负责维护节点的状态信息,包括在线/离线状态、负载情况等,以便于任务调度和故障恢复

    同时,它还具备故障监测和恢复功能,能够在节点出现故障时迅速响应,确保系统的稳定运行

     应用场景 节点服务器广泛应用于各类分布式系统中,包括但不限于: 1.区块链网络:在区块链网络中,每个节点服务器都维护着网络中的数据和交易记录

    它们通过共识算法验证交易的合法性,并将新的交易打包成区块添加到链上

    节点服务器之间的紧密协作确保了区块链网络的稳定性和安全性

     2.大规模数据处理:在Hadoop、Spark等分布式数据处理平台中,节点服务器将任务分发给各个节点,并将计算结果进行汇总

    这种分布式处理方式极大地提高了数据处理的速度和效率

     3.云计算:云计算平台中的节点服务器负责管理和调度云主机的资源和任务

    它们能够根据用户需求动态调整云主机的分配和释放,确保任务的高可靠性和高性能

     4.物联网:在物联网系统中,节点服务器连接和管理大量的物联网设备,提供统一的接口和协议

    它们根据设备的在线/离线状态和负载情况动态分配任务给设备,确保通信的可靠性和实时性

     结论 综上所述,节点服务器作为分布式系统的核心力量,以其高可靠性、高扩

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道